Chapter 4. RS-232 Commands
17
Save / Load Profile Commands
The formulas for Save/Load Profile commands are as follows:
1. Command + Profile + Number + Control + [Enter]
For example, to save the current connection configuration to profile 01, type
the following:
profile f 01 save [Enter]
2. Command + Profile + Number + Control + [Enter]
For example, to load profile 01, type the following:
profile f 01 load [Enter]
Possible Values
The following table shows the possible values for Save/load Profile
commands:
Profile Command Table:
Command Description
profile Save / Load profile
Profile Description
fProfile
Profile Number Description
yy 00-07 (default is 00)
Control Description
save Save the current connection configuration
load Load a saved profile
Command Profile Num1 Control Enter Description
profile f yy save [Enter Key] Save current connection
configuration to profile yy
(yy:00~07)
(Default: 00)
profile f yy load [Enter Key] Load saved profile yy
(yy:00~07)
(Default: 00)
